Security and Privacy: Protecting Your Conversations
With increased reliance on digital communication comes the critical need for security and privacy. Your messenger app often carries sensitive information, from personal anecdotes to confidential business discussions. It's paramount to understand the security measures available. End-to-end encryption, for instance, is a feature offered by many leading messenger apps, ensuring that only you and the intended recipient can read your messages.
Beyond built-in encryption, consider your login security. Using strong, unique passwords for your messenger login is non-negotiable. Enabling two-factor authentication, if available, adds an extra layer of protection against unauthorized access. Furthermore, be mindful of what you share. While convenient, avoid sending highly sensitive personal information like bank details or passwords through instant messaging platforms unless you are absolutely certain of the app's security and the recipient's trustworthiness.

Staying Organized and Efficient
As your digital social circle grows, so does the volume of messages. Keeping track of conversations can become a challenge. Fortunately, most messenger apps offer organizational tools. Features like archiving chats, starring important messages, or using search functions can help you quickly find what you need. Think about message pinning. This allows you to keep crucial conversations at the top of your list, ensuring they don't get lost in the shuffle. Some apps also allow for message search within specific chats, which is a lifesaver when you're trying to recall a particular detail discussed weeks ago.
